FBI warns cyber-enabled cargo theft is surging as losses hit $725 million in 2025

#MarketWarnings The U.S. FBI (Federal Bureau of Investigation), through its Internet Crime Complaint Center, warned in a public service announcement that cyber-enabled strategic cargo theft is surging, as threat actors increasingly impersonate legitimate brokers and carriers to hijack freight and reroute high-value shipments for resale. Losses reached nearly US$725 million across the U.S. and Canada in 2025, marking a 60% year over year increase, with incidents up 18% and average losses per theft rising to $273,990.
Published last week, the FBI alert says attackers gain unauthorized access to logistics systems through phishing and spoofed communications, then post fraudulent loads or manipulate legitimate shipments.
“Cyber threat actors target US transportation and logistics sectors, including companies with interests in shipping, receiving, delivering, and insuring cargo,” the FBI alert detailed. “Since at least 2024, cyber threat actors have gained unauthorized access to the computer systems of brokers and carriers — typically via spoofed emails, fake URLs, and compromised carrier accounts. The cyber actors pose as victim companies and post fraudulent listings on load boards1 to deceive shippers, brokers, and carriers into handing over goods, which are redirected from their intended destination and stolen for resale.”
In 2025, the alert noted that the estimated cargo theft losses in the U.S. and Canada surged to nearly $725 million, marking a 60% increase from 2024, while confirmed cargo theft incidents increased by 18%. The average value per theft rose 36% to $273,990, driven by more selective, high-value targets.
The FBI outlined a coordinated, multi-step scheme behind the rise in cyber-enabled strategic cargo theft, describing how threat actors first compromise broker and carrier accounts through phishing links that deploy remote access tools, giving them undetected control of logistics systems. Once inside, attackers flood trucking load boards with tens of thousands of fraudulent listings while also bidding on legitimate shipments using hijacked identities, enabling them to double-broker loads to unsuspecting drivers and alter key documentation such as bills of lading and delivery destinations
To sustain the deception, actors manipulate carrier contact and insurance details with regulators, delaying detection until shipments go missing. The operation culminates in the physical theft of goods, with cargo rerouted, cross-docked, or transloaded to complicit drivers for resale, and in some cases, followed by ransom demands to reveal shipment locations.
The agency called upon organizations to watch for signs of cyber-enabled cargo theft schemes, including unexpected contact from brokers, dispatchers, or carriers about shipments made in a company’s name without authorization. Indicators also include email spoofing legitimate domains through free providers, often substituting addresses for authentic ones, as well as requests to download documents from shortened or spoofed links. Messages may reference negative service reviews and prompt recipients to click links to ‘resolve’ complaints, leading to malicious downloads.
FBI noted that compromised accounts may show newly created or unauthorized mailbox rules, such as automatic forwarding to external addresses, deletion settings, or hidden folders. Additional warning signs include domains that mimic legitimate ones through subtle changes, including extra punctuation, altered top-level domains, added prefixes or suffixes, or slight misspellings
Hackers also communicate through spoofed email addresses that insert job titles into otherwise legitimate formats, while phone contact is often made באמצעות short-lived voice over internet protocol numbers or applications, sometimes linked to overseas activity.

当避险资产开始下跌,真正的才刚露头

----黄金和白银正在被抛售,这不是一个可以被忽略的信号。
据财联社报道,国际金银价格持续走低:
• 现货黄金单日跌 6.46%
• 现货白银跌幅更是达到 13.09%
先说结论:
这不是单纯的“贵金属行情”,而是一轮更大范围风险定价变化的外显结果。
而加密市场,恰恰处在这条传导链上。

一、为什么黄金下跌,反而值得警惕?
在多数人的直觉里,黄金下跌通常被解读为:
• 风险偏好上升
• 市场更“乐观”
• 资金转向成长资产
但这一次,逻辑并不干净。
黄金和白银同时、大幅下跌,更像是“流动性抽离”,而不是风险偏好回升。
几个关键背景不能忽略:
1️⃣ 高利率环境仍未松动
在真实利率维持高位的情况下,黄金这种“无息资产”本身就承压。
2️⃣ 部分机构在主动降杠杆、补保证金
当市场某些角落出现压力,最先被卖掉的,往往不是风险资产,而是流动性最好、最容易出手的“安全资产”。
3️⃣ 避险资产同步下跌,通常意味着:不是风险结束,而是风险正在换一种形式出现。
这在历史上并不少见。

二、这对加密市场意味着什么?
这里要打破一个常见误区。
很多人会说:
“黄金跌了,钱会不会来 BTC?”
这种线性推导,在 2026 年之前的宏观环境里,并不成立。
更现实的传导路径是:
黄金 / 白银下跌 → 资金收缩 → 风险资产先震荡,而不是立刻受益
对加密市场来说,有三个潜在影响需要警惕。

三、三个加密市场需要警惕的风险信号
1️⃣ “宏观避险”并不会立刻流向 BTC
虽然 BTC 常被称为“数字黄金”,
但在真实世界的资产配置里,它仍然被归类为高波动风险资产。
当机构在做风险控制时:
• 第一阶段:卖黄金、卖白银、卖流动性资产
• 第二阶段:才是压缩高波动仓位
也就是说,BTC 并不是第一受益者,反而可能是第二波被波及的对象。

2️⃣ 高 Beta 山寨币,对流动性变化最敏感
如果你盯盘够久,会发现一个规律:
每一轮宏观收缩,最先“失真”的不是 BTC,而是中小市值山寨。
原因很简单:
• 流动性薄
• 杠杆高
• 做市深度有限
一旦市场开始“减少风险敞口”,这些币的下跌速度,往往快于你刷新行情的速度。

3️⃣ “利好叙事”在风险切换期会突然失效
在趋势行情中:
• AI
• RWA
• Layer2
• DePIN
都可以讲故事。
但在风险定价切换阶段,市场只看三件事:
• 能不能立刻变现
• 有没有真实现金流
• 有没有被动抛压
很多你以为“基本面很强”的项目,在这个阶段都会暴露出:
叙事很新,但资金很旧。

四、现在该怎么应对?(不是建议你清仓)
这不是一篇让你恐慌的文章,而是一个节奏提醒。
几个相对稳妥的思路:
• 降低整体杠杆:不管你多看好某个方向
• 减少纯情绪仓位:只靠“下一个热点”的币,风险在放大
• 关注链上真实资金行为:而不是时间线的情绪共振
• 给现金一点尊重:在风险切换期,现金也是一种仓位
记住一句话:
当避险资产被抛售时,市场往往不是在庆祝,而是在自保。

五、最后的总结
黄金和白银的大幅下跌,并不是加密市场的直接利好或利空。
它更像一个提醒:
这一轮市场,正在从“讲故事阶段”,过渡到“算账阶段”。
在这种环境下:
• 活下来的,通常不是最激进的
• 而是节奏感最好的
市场不会每天给你机会逃顶,
但它总会提前给你一些不太舒服的信号。
你是否选择看见,决定了你下一轮站在哪里。
